1. Check SBI Account Balance Through Mobile Banking
SBI Mobile banking application (SBI YONO Lite) is available on the play store and iOS store. You can install and activate this official mobile banking on your phone and use banking services online.
You can check your SBI account balance using SBI YONO Lite instantly anywhere and anytime from your phone.
Just log in to the SBI Mobile Banking application.
Tap on My Accounts.
Next screen select Account Summary.
And next screen tap on Account Summary to view your account balance.
2. Check SBI Account Balance through SBI YONO
SBI YONO is another digital mobile banking application offered by the bank. You can activate this application using your net banking credentials.
To check your account balance through SBI YONO, login to the SBI YONO application.
Now tap on Accounts.
And next screen you can see your net available balance.
3. Check SBI Account Balance using Net Banking
SBI Internet banking is a free online banking service from the bank. You can activate net banking for your account online using an ATM card and access many online banking services at home.
You can check your SBI account balance using net banking anytime from your phone or PC.
Just open net banking and login to your account.
After login, you can see your account summary where you can view your account balance or click on My Accounts.
4. Check SBI Account Balance by SMS
If you don’t have an SBI net banking and mobile banking facility then still you can check your account balance on your phone instantly. Yes, the bank has launched SMS based banking, so you can send an SMS from your bank registered mobile number to receive account balance via SMS.
First, register your account number to check account balance by SMS:
- Send “REG<space>Account number” and send it to 09223488888 (e.g: REG 3881808301)
After registering your account number, now you can send SMS to check your account balance.
- Type “BAL” and send to 092237 66666
You will receive your account balance instantly via SMS after sending the above SMS.
5. Check SBI Account balance through Toll-free number
Do you know, SBI also offers a toll-free number to know your account balance. You just need to dial this toll-free number from your bank registered mobile number and you will get your account balance via SMS instantly.
First, you need to register your account number for this service:
- Send “REG<space>Account number & send to 09223488888
After registering your number, now you can dial the below number to check your account balance.
Dial this number to check balance: 092237 66666
6. Check SBI Account Balance using UPI Application
You can also check your SBI account balance using any UPI application. If you don’t have net banking or mobile banking then this method is the best option to check your SBI account balance online.
Just install any UPI application like Paytm, PhonePe, Google Pay, BHIM or you can also install official SBI pay UPI application.
You just need to add your bank account and create your UPI PIN using the ATM card and then you are ready to check your balance anytime anywhere.
Here we have used Google Pay UPI application, now see how to check account balance:
Open Google Pay and tap on Check Account Balance.
Next screen select your SBI account and enter UPI PIN.
And here you can see your account balance.
Similarly, you can use any UPI application to check your SBI account balance.
